About Nicolae Palibroda

Nicolae Palibroda is a scholar working on Biochemistry, Pharmaceutical Science and Spectroscopy, having authored 47 papers that have together received 460 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Enzyme Structure and Function (8 papers), Amino Acid Enzymes and Metabolism (7 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(7 papers),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(6 papers), Organophosphorus compounds synthesis (5 papers),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(4 papers), Biochemical and Molecular Research (4 papers) and Synthesis and biological activity (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Environmental Chemistry (77 citations), Biochemistry (41 citations) and Toxicology (19 citations). Nicolae Palibroda has collaborated with scholars based in Romania, France and Cameroon. Frequent co-authors include Octavian Bârzu, Rosmarie Rippka, Nicole Tandeau de Marsac, Rómulo Aráoz, Michael Herdman, Bonaventure T. Ngadjui, Charles Fokunang, Victor Kuete, Valentin Zaharia and Bathélémy Ngameni. Their work appears in journals such as Rapid Communications in Mass Spectrometry, Analytical Biochemistry, Journal of Biological Chemistry, Chromatographia and Journal of Mass Spectrometry.
